Transaction 72500662805d144d78c6c64062a8c0c72c2376f216311b86590e4c1d3bc817f7
1 Input
1 Output
-
72500662805d144d78c6c64062a8c0c72c2376f216311b86590e4c1d3bc817f7:0
- value
- 71666937
- script pubkey
- OP_0 OP_PUSHBYTES_20 661c186e3535261b5800427c239d126c52d06b8e
- address
- ltc1qvcwpsm34x5npkkqqgf7z88gjd3fdq6uwyv3a8r